What is Space Ethics?

Space ethics is a multidisciplinary field that examines the moral implications of human activities in outer space. It encompasses a wide range of issues, from the responsibilities of space-faring nations to the rights of extraterrestrial life forms. As humanity ventures further into the cosmos, understanding space ethics becomes essential to ensure that our exploration and utilization of space are conducted responsibly and sustainably.

Key Aspects of Space Ethics

When discussing space ethics, several fundamental aspects come to light:

1. Resource Utilization

One of the biggest ethical dilemmas revolves around the extraction of resources from celestial bodies. The Outer Space Treaty of 1967 prohibits the appropriation of outer space by any one nation; however, it does not specifically address resource utilization. This leads to questions about:

  • How should resources be shared among nations?
  • What happens if one nation monopolizes a resource?

For example, mining asteroids for precious metals could lead to significant economic benefits but also raises concerns about equity and sustainability.

2. The Rights of Extraterrestrial Life

As we explore the possibility of life beyond Earth, we must consider the ethical implications of our actions. If we discover extraterrestrial organisms, should we protect them? The principle of planetary protection emphasizes the need to avoid contaminating other worlds, which is crucial for preserving potential alien life forms.

  • Should we prioritize scientific discovery over the protection of extraterrestrial ecosystems?
  • What ethical obligations do we owe to non-human life forms?

These questions are vital as we prepare for missions to Mars and beyond, where the potential for discovering life exists.

3. Contamination and Planetary Protection

Contamination of other planets and moons is a major concern in space ethics. Human missions could inadvertently introduce Earth microbes to extraterrestrial environments, potentially endangering native ecosystems. The planetary protection protocols aim to minimize this risk.

  • How do we ensure that our missions do not compromise the integrity of other worlds?
  • What responsibilities do we have to maintain the scientific value of these environments?

For instance, missions to Mars are subject to strict sterilization procedures to prevent contamination.

4. Intergenerational Responsibility

As we venture into space, we must consider our responsibilities to future generations. This involves ensuring that our actions today do not jeopardize the ability of future humans to explore and utilize space.

  • What legacy do we want to leave behind?
  • How can we ensure that space remains accessible for future explorers?

Decisions about space resource utilization and environmental protection should prioritize long-term sustainability, balancing short-term gains with the needs of future generations.
